The chemistry rules approach ended up being the basis for the original three-dimensional biomolecular structure file format, the PDB format from the Protein Data Bank at Brookhaven (Bernstein et al., 1977). These records, in general, lack complete bond information for biopolymers. The working assumption is that no residue dictionary is required for interpretation of data encoded by this approach, just a table of bond lengths and bond types for every conceivable pair of bonded atoms is required. [Pg.85]

Trade name for tech lauroyl peroxide manufd by the Lucidol Division of Wallace Tieraan, Inc, Buffalo, NY Alpha-Cellulose is that portion of cellulosic materialfpulp, paper, etc) which,after treatment with 17,5% NaOH(mercerized strength) at 20° and diln to 7.3% NaOH,can be separated by filtration. The residue of alpha-cellulose is a good index of the undegraded cellulose content of the material. The alkali treatment removes degraded(oxidized or hydrolyzed) cellulose and short chain material. Various numbering methods have been used to indicate substitution or other modification in or of the residues of a peptide. The method now recommended by lUPAC and introduced into the Dictionary of Natural Products (see Section 1.2.1) uses numerical locants of the type 3, where 3 is the locant of the substituent in the amino acid residue and 2 is the amino acid position in the ring or chain, numbered from the N-terminal end, which is standard for all peptides). A/ -methyloxytocin would indicate a methyl substituent on N-5 of the glutamine residue at position 4 of oxytocin. [Pg.93]
